Learn To Row with The Nationally Ranked Tulsa Rowing Club Juniors


Team Hosts Learn To Row Week Feb 22nd-26th, 2010


7th and 8th Grade Team runs from March 1st through May 6th


TULSA OK - The Tulsa Rowing Club Juniors Team will offer a Learn-To-Row week to recruit high school age athletes interested in learning how to row in racing shells. Lessons will be held at the Tulsa Rowing Club Boathouse located on the west bank of the Arkansas River at 715 West 21st Street. Learn to Row sessions run Monday, Feb 22nd through Friday, Feb 26th from 4:15PM to 6:15PM. The fee for the week of coaching and equipment is $150, which will be pro-rated towards the rowing club membership fee if a participant decides to join for the season. Interested participants must submit an application and complete a swim test at a local YMCA. Required forms and information about the juniors program can be found at www.tulsajuniorsrowing.org


This past season the Tulsa Rowing Club Juniors won Gold medals in Oklahoma City and Wichita, KS in the many different events. The team also competed at the Head of the Hooch in Tennessee, placing in the top fifteen crews in the girls’ varsity eight. In addition, Jenks senior Courtenay Miller signed to row at the Division I level for S.M.U. starting in the fall of 2010.


The Tulsa Rowing Club is presently expanding its facilities by adding an extra bay to accommodate the increased demand for rowing in the community. This bay will be ready for use in early February.


"I'm excited to see so much growth and demand for rowing in Tulsa. We have come a long way in the last few years. We are planning for upwards of seventy youth rowers (high school and middle school) for the spring season," said Neil Bergenroth, Head Coach of the Tulsa Rowing Club Juniors.
